How much do live in travel nanny j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for live in travel nanny in Utah is $21.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.39 and $24.52 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a live in travel nanny?

A Live In Travel Nanny is a childcare professional who resides with a family and travels with them as needed. They provide full-time care, ensuring the children's needs are met while adapting to new locations and routines. Responsibilities often include childcare, educational activities, meal preparation, and maintaining a safe environment. Flexibility, travel readiness, and experience with children in various settings are essential for this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a live in travel nanny?

To thrive as a Live In Travel Nanny, you need experience in child care, a flexible schedule, cultural adaptability, and often a background in early childhood education or a related field. Knowledge of first aid, CPR certification, and familiarity with travel logistics or multilingual skills are highly beneficial. Exceptional organization, adaptability, and the ability to proactively communicate with both children and parents set top candidates apart. These skills and qualities are vital for ensuring child safety, fostering enriching experiences, and successfully meeting the dynamic needs of families who travel frequently.

What are some of the unique challenges a live in travel nanny might face while traveling with families?

As a Live In Travel Nanny, you may encounter challenges such as frequent schedule changes, adapting to new environments, and managing the needs of children across different time zones or cultures. Being away from your own home for extended periods requires a high degree of flexibility and resilience. You'll also need to maintain routines and provide comfort to children in unfamiliar settings, all while respecting the family's privacy and preferences. These experiences can be rewarding and allow you to develop strong relationships and cultural awareness, but they require dedication, adaptability, and excellent problem-solving skills.

Full-Time Live- in Nanny - Starting as early as September 2, 2016:

We are looking for that amazing woman who is loving, nurturing, domestic, good at balancing the needs of children and home, is competent with young kids, can cook or at least has basic cooking skills, energetic, honest, solution oriented, cheerful, genuine, patient, apt to teaching, and has a win-win resolution approach. Must be wiling and able to clean.  Cleaning is required every day (including dishes, laundry, and help cleaning bedrooms).  Nanny must be able to provide a minimum of a one-year commitment, able to make our families needs their top priority, have a flexible schedule, be at least 18 years or older, and have a drivers license with a good drivers record.  *Single mothers (of no more than one child) are welcome to apply. Must keep BYU living standards. Must be ok occasionally watching children overnight. Background check required. Cell phone and social media must be managed appropriately during work hours.

Work hours:

M-F 

8am-6pm

Sat: Occasional help as needed (extra pay)

Sun: off

Once a month overnight stay (extra pay)

May be needed on occasion to stay late, come early or be responsible for the children overnight. Additional compensation will be given for overnight childcare. Time spent over hours will be paid out at a specified rate (depending upon experience). Days of the week, and times of day may vary slightly depending upon moms schedule, and may change as needed by the family.


Preferences, but not musts:

Musical (Piano and Voice)

Returned Missionary


Nice to have:

Fluent Mandarin Chinese


Ages of 4 Children:

17 months- boy

6 years - boy (1st grade, Chinese Immersion)

7 years - girl (2nd grade, Chinese Immersion)

8 years - boy ( 3rd grade Chinese Immersion and has a mild to moderate case of cerebral palsy)


Compensation:

Brand new Limited RAV4, (to use after work hours for personal use) & Insurance Provided (for work and personal use. Gas budget included.  

Private Room with walk out entrance, Bathroom & Board (Access to entertainment room, kitchen, internet, food, private refrigerator, exercise room (treadmill, weight bench, etc) massage chair, craft room, television with Netflix, Amazon Instant Video, Hulu, Watch ESPN, so forth), wrap around porch, hot tub, fire pit and beautifully landscaped land.  There is a park next door and a walking and biking trail across the street.  Hiking trails are within walking distance.

Hourly Flat Rate (depending upon experience) + performance bonuses + living expenses (see above inclusions).
